打开 CSV 文件
Opening CSV File
我正在生成 CSV 文件。我的第一行是列名,看起来像
User ID;First Name;Last Name;Email;...
但是如果我将用户 ID 更改为 ID,MS office 无法打开此 csv 并显示错误 "Cannot read record(number of record)"。但是这个文件打开正确,例如,notepad++。我正在使用 Excel 2013。有什么问题吗?
您可以通过在 .csv 文件的开头(第一行)插入以下简单文本来解决问题:
sep=;
在Excel中打开文件时将看不到此内容。它会做什么 - 它会明确告诉 Excel 分隔符是 ;
,并且值将被分隔到单独的单元格中。此外,您还可以使用 ID
作为列的标题。不幸的是,我无法回答为什么 Excel 不喜欢你在文件开头使用这个标题。
我正在生成 CSV 文件。我的第一行是列名,看起来像
User ID;First Name;Last Name;Email;...
但是如果我将用户 ID 更改为 ID,MS office 无法打开此 csv 并显示错误 "Cannot read record(number of record)"。但是这个文件打开正确,例如,notepad++。我正在使用 Excel 2013。有什么问题吗?
您可以通过在 .csv 文件的开头(第一行)插入以下简单文本来解决问题:
sep=;
在Excel中打开文件时将看不到此内容。它会做什么 - 它会明确告诉 Excel 分隔符是 ;
,并且值将被分隔到单独的单元格中。此外,您还可以使用 ID
作为列的标题。不幸的是,我无法回答为什么 Excel 不喜欢你在文件开头使用这个标题。